❤️ Friday, Feb. 6 is National Wear Red Day ❤️
Today we wear red with purpose — to honor the millions of women affected by heart disease and stroke and to raise awareness about the #1 killer of women.

Cardiovascular disease is the leading cause of death in women, claiming the lives of 1 in 3 women — more than all forms of cancer combined. Nearly 45% of women age 20 and older are living with some form of cardiovascular disease.

This National Wear Red Day, we stand together to educate, inspire, and remind one another that heart disease and stroke are largely preventable with awareness, healthy habits, and early detection.

Kent Harms has been a valued member of Van Diest Medical Center’s Environmental Services Department for the past 19 years, serving as a floor specialist and helping keep our hospital clean, welcoming, and looking its best. Kent takes pride in his work and enjoys the visible impact it has throughout the building.

“I like making the building look better from cleaning floors and carpets and other areas,” Kent shared.

One of the things Kent appreciates most about VDMC is the people. “I enjoy working with everyone here,” he said, noting the friendly atmosphere that makes each day enjoyable.

Outside of work, Kent enjoys spending time outdoors fishing and camping, along with making memories with his family. He also proudly became a grandfather in October 2022—a role he treasures just as much as his work at VDMC.
